Review of the VQ35 Engine
Established as component of Nissan's VQ engine family, the VQ35 engine is a 3.5-liter V6 powerplant that has gathered a credibility for its equilibrium of performance and efficiency. Introduced in the very early 2000s, this engine has been employed in various Nissan and Infiniti designs, consisting of the Murano, Altima, and 350Z. Its layout includes a light weight aluminum alloy block and DOHC (Double Expenses Camshaft) configuration, which add to its small and lightweight nature.
The VQ35 engine features a 60-degree V-angle and utilizes variable valve timing modern technology, enhancing both power distribution and gas efficiency. With a maximum result normally around 280 horse power and 270 lb-ft of torque, it provides sufficient efficiency for a mid-sized SUV. The engine is also recognized for its smooth operation and reasonably low noise degrees, making it suitable for family-oriented automobiles like the Murano.

Typical Concerns
While the VQ35 engine is celebrated for its total Reliability, it is not without its share of usual issues that owners might experience. Discover More One frequent worry entails the engine's oil consumption. Lots of VQ35 proprietors report extreme oil burning, which can bring about low oil degrees and potential engine damages if not addressed immediately.
Another problem relates to the timing chain. vq35. The VQ35 is outfitted with a timing chain instead than a belt, which generally requires much less upkeep, some proprietors have actually experienced chain stretch and linked rattling noises, particularly in older designs. This can cause extreme engine damages if not identified early
Additionally, the engine may experience from coolant leaks, especially at the consumption manifold. Such leakages can bring about overheating and subsequent engine failure if not handled.
Finally, the mass airflow sensor (MAF) can fail, triggering efficiency problems such as rough idling and a decline in gas efficiency. vq35.
